🧠 What to Look for Before You Buy

Choosing a kitchen thermometer on a budget is trickier than it seems because many models promise accuracy but deliver slow, inconsistent readings that ruin timing in cooking. Budget shoppers often chase fancy specs like high max temperature or flashy LCDs, overlooking the real-world factors that matter most: reading speed, probe durability, and ease of calibration.

Reading Speed and Accuracy

A thermometer that takes 10+ seconds to register temperature isn’t just inconvenient; it risks overcooking your food before you get a reading. Aim for models with instant-read capabilities (under 5 seconds) and ±1°F accuracy. Beware of cheap models that only provide an average temperature after a delay — they’re unreliable for grilling or baking where precision timing counts.

Probe Build Quality and Waterproofing

Probes are the thermometer’s lifeline to your food. In budget models, probes may use thin metal or flimsy joints that bend or break easily. Look for stainless steel probes with a decent thickness and waterproof or splash-proof ratings to tolerate kitchen messes. Models without waterproofing risk internal damage from steam or spills.

Display and Usability

A clear, backlit digital display is a must-have for quick reading, especially in low-light conditions like outdoor grilling. Also, consider whether the probe folds for compact storage or has a magnetic back for easy fridge mounting. These ergonomic touches improve day-to-day convenience.

Calibration and Warranty

Calibration options are rare but valuable in budget thermometers, allowing you to maintain accuracy over time. Also, check warranty terms; spending a few extra dollars on a model with a 1-year warranty can save money if it fails early. The cheapest options may lack support, so weigh the trade-off based on your usage frequency.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ions

How fast should a good budget kitchen thermometer give me a reading?

Fast is critical: a reliable budget kitchen thermometer should deliver accurate readings within 3-5 seconds. Anything slower risks heat loss from food and can throw off cooking times, especially when grilling or baking.

Are budget kitchen thermometers accurate enough for meat safety?

Yes, many budget models achieve ±1°F accuracy, which is adequate for safe cooking temperatures. Prioritize models with consistent performance and avoid no-name brands that may have erratic readings.

Should I get a foldable probe or a fixed probe?

Foldable probes improve portability and protect the sensor, but fixed probes tend to be sturdier. For frequent outdoor use or grilling, choose based on your storage preference and durability needs.

What's the difference between waterproof and splash-proof thermometers?

Waterproof thermometers (like those with IP67 ratings) can be submerged and tolerate cleaning under water, boosting longevity. Splash-proof models resist spills and steam but shouldn’t be submerged. Waterproof is better for heavy kitchen use.

How long do budget kitchen thermometers typically last?
